WATKINS GLEN, N.Y. (AP) _ Watkins Glen International needs a
title sponsor for its NASCAR Sprint Cup race after Centurion Boats
opted out of the final year of its contract.
Company officials said the decision was based on the downturn of
the national economy.
Les Clark, East Coast general manager for Fineline Industries,
the parent company of Centurion Boats, said production has been cut
50 percent, resulting in layoffs of half the work force at its
North Carolina manufacturing facility.
The Glen's Cup race returns for its 24th consecutive year in
August.
